feat(plugin): P1-P4 审计修复 — 第二批 (运行时监控 + 通知引擎 + 编号reset)
2.1 运行时监控:
- LoadedPlugin 新增 RuntimeMetrics (调用次数/错误/响应时间/燃料消耗)
- execute_wasm 自动采集每次调用的耗时和状态
- GET /admin/plugins/{id}/metrics 端点
2.2 通知规则引擎:
- notification.rs: 订阅 plugin.trigger.* 事件
- 触发时自动给管理员发送消息通知
- emit_trigger_events 增加 manifest_id 到 payload
2.3 编号 reset_rule:
- 替换 PostgreSQL SEQUENCE 为表行 + pg_advisory_xact_lock
- 支持 daily/monthly/yearly/never 重置周期
- 每个周期独立计数,切换时自动重置为 1
